Auburn city, Maine Population By All Races in Census 2020

Updated on June 29, 2023.

According to the data from the US 2020 decennial Census, in April 2020, among Auburn city, ME population of 24,061 people, 87.74% (21,111 people) identified their race as White Alone, 5.50% (1,323 people) identified their race as Two Or More Races, and 4.47% (1,076 people) identified their race as Black or African American Alone.

Auburn city, ME Population By All Races in Census 2020
Items per page:
0 of 0
Race Population % of City or Place Population
Black or African American Alone 1076 4.47
White Alone 21111 87.74
American Indian and Alaska Native Alone 92 0.38
Asian Alone 237 0.99
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one 12 0.05
Some Other Race Alone 210 0.87
Two Or More Races 1323 5.50
